Studyon Bending Performance Steel Reinforced Recycled Aggregate Concrete Beams With Full Substitution Rate After Fire
In order to study the flexural performance of recycled steel reinforced concrete(SRRAC)beams with full substitution rate after fire,the finite element model was used to analyze the effects of fire time,recycled coarse aggregate substitution rate,steel and recycled concrete strength parameters on the flexural properties of the components.The results showed that the fire time had a significant effect on the flexural performance of the components,and the concrete bearing capacity decreased by 17.9%~29.4%when the fire time was 30~60 min,and the concrete bearing capacity decreased within 10%when the fire time was more than 60 min.The substitution rate,steel strength and concrete strength had little influence on the bearing capacity.There was little difference in the internal temperature of the components between the same fire time and different substitution rates.
